Speech and language disorders encompass a diverse range of conditions that can significantly impact an individual's ability to communicate effectively. This topic explores the intricate landscape of speech and language interventions, addressing the multifaceted approaches employed to support individuals with diverse needs. From collaborative goal setting and technology-assisted interventions to the importance of cultural and linguistic considerations, the field has evolved to embrace individualized and inclusive strategies. Professionals in this domain navigate the complexities of neurodiversity, emphasizing personalized approaches that celebrate unique strengths. This discussion delves into the collaborative, adaptive nature of interventions, highlighting the critical roles of progress monitoring and continuous learning in shaping effective speech and language support. Through these interventions, the goal is not only to enhance communication skills but also to foster a holistic, person-centered approach that empowers individuals on their unique communication journeys.Published
